Just a quick background and my own opinions:
| I was originally ready to attend the Rice MBA back in 2016/2017, but put it on hold due to not knowing my “why”. If you are not crystal clear and have good introspection about the MBA and yourself, it will not automatically make you successful. |
I ended up taking the money I would have spent getting the MBA and invested it in real estate instead. I then started my own business on the side while working full time in engineering (IT business). I decided to get an MS in Engineering, because I still was not certain I wanted to go the business route completely.
Fast forward a few years and I have a lot that I am able to reflect on with a lot of real life failures at work and in my own personal ambitions. I am closer to now knowing my “why” and ready to consider an MBA.
I always consider things on ROI now and long term cash flow. Basically put, can I invest that same money over the course of 30-40 years and will it underperform my MBA investment or outperform. The scholarship really helps balance that equation.
